When Sonia developed lymphoedema after breast cancer treatment, she initially felt overwhelmed and anxious about managing the lifelong condition. With compassionate support from the specialist lymphoedema team at CCC, she regained her confidence, discovered a passion for dragon boat racing and went on to win four silver medals on the international stage.
Sonia has been living with lymphoedema since 2021, due to the removal of lymph nodes under her arm whilst going through treatment for breast cancer.
The 46-year-old from Wallasey is sharing her story to help others going through the same and to thank The Clatterbridge Cancer Centre Lymphoedema Team for their support, as initially dealing with the symptoms had a major emotional impact on her mental health, particularly when she noticed her arm beginning to swell.
"I felt ashamed and didn’t want anyone to know. The thought of wearing a compression sleeve was terrifying, but the team took the time to listen. Their empathy and emotional support made such a difference."
Lymphoedema can occur when lymph nodes are removed or damaged by cancer treatment, affecting the flow of lymphatic fluid and causing swelling in the surrounding tissue. The condition cannot be cured, but it can be managed through consistent care, compression, exercise, skin care and specialist support.
With the encouragement of Cathy and Clare, Macmillan clinical nurse specialists in lymphoedema at CCC-Wirral, Sonia joined Pool of Life, a dragon boat racing team for people affected by breast cancer. She has since represented the Breast Cancer GB team, winning four silver medals at her most recent competition in Munich.
"Dragon boat racing changed my whole attitude. If it wasn’t for lymphoedema, I wouldn’t have my medals!
"The swelling in my arm has reduced significantly since taking part in regular exercise as well, and talking to others who have been through something similar helps you realise you are stronger than you think.
"I can’t thank Cathy and Clare enough for their constant support to get me to a place I feel confident and empowered within myself – sleeve and all!"
